Made Thought is an award-winning international design studio that imagines, creates and implements compelling strategies, brand identities and communications that inspire change and innovation. A team of 80, across London and New York, we have built a studio of intentionally diverse creativity, known for our deep strategic thinking, iconic visual style and obsessive attention to detail. Comprised of thinkers and designers, makers and crafters, writers and filmmakers, digital wizards, opinion formers and social connectors.
Made Thought collaborates with cutting-edge and leading brands of tomorrow, from Adidas, Feeld, MoMa, Pinterest, to Stella McCartney and Chandon. Our core purpose is to use the currency of creativity to deliver change for brands and the world in which they operate. Be that to culturally move a brand forward, commercially add value to that business or help the brand think deeply about its place in the world and its responsibility to the planet.
Made Thought are also part of The New Standard alongside Map Project Office and Universal Design Studio – a new collective that connects brand, spatial, industrial and digital design into a single and cohesive creative ecosystem. This year we released our inaugural magazine that investigates the power that creativity holds to disrupt the status quo. Made Thought are part of AKQA Group.
The Senior Management Accountant is a key member of the Finance Team, reporting to the Finance Director and working closely with the wider Made Thought team. This pivotal role is responsible for leading the production of accurate, timely management accounts and providing insightful financial analysis to support commercial decision-making, budgeting, and forecasting across the business.
